Anantnag man gets 9 year imprisonment for murdering brother over property dispute

Suhail Dar

A court in the Anantnag district of Jammu Kashmir awarded life imprisonment to a man for killing his brother with an axe in a bid to grab his property nearly nine years ago.

Ghulam Nabi Bhat son of Mal Akad, resident of  Anantnag killed his 33-year-old brother, Mohammad Shafi, on 3 March 2013 over a property dispute.

Naseer Ahmad Dar, the Principal Sessions Judge Anantnag also imposed a fine of Rs 10,000 on the convict.

The deceased is survived by a widow and three children, who were minors at the time of the murder in 2013. “While passing the sentence upon the convict, the question of compensation of the victims of the crime is also to be taken into consideration,” the court said.
